Abstract

An automated fastener insert installation system for composite panels is provided. A first module receives and secures a composite panel with respect to an origin of a first coordinate system, wherein the composite panel has opposed major surfaces and defines an insert-receiving orifice extending through one of the major surfaces, and is secured such that one of the major surfaces is externally accessible. A second module engages each of a plurality of fastener inserts with an installation aide. Third module determines a configuration of the orifice defined by the composite panel, selects a corresponding one of the fastener inserts engaged with the installation aide, inserts the selected fastener insert into the orifice, and dispenses an adhesive material through the installation aide and into the orifice about selected fastener insert such that the adhesive material secures the selected fastener insert within the orifice. Associated systems are also provided.
